Compare commits

...

2 Commits

View File

@@ -89,6 +89,7 @@ void process_received_message(string mac, string id,const char* data, size_t len
std::cout << "cloud login: " << mac << " state: " << static_cast<int>(udata[16]) << static_cast<int>(udata[17]) << static_cast<int>(udata[18]) << static_cast<int>(udata[19]) << std::endl; std::cout << "cloud login: " << mac << " state: " << static_cast<int>(udata[16]) << static_cast<int>(udata[17]) << static_cast<int>(udata[18]) << static_cast<int>(udata[19]) << std::endl;
if (udata[19] == 0x10) { if (udata[19] == 0x10) {
std::cout << "cloud login: " << mac << " state: success!" << std::endl; std::cout << "cloud login: " << mac << " state: success!" << std::endl;
DIY_INFOLOG_CODE(id,1, static_cast<int>(LogCode::LOG_CODE_COMM),"云前置登录成功");
//装置登录成功 //装置登录成功
ClientManager::instance().set_cloud_status(id, 1); //设置了云前置登录状态为已登录 ClientManager::instance().set_cloud_status(id, 1); //设置了云前置登录状态为已登录
ClientManager::instance().read_devversion_action_to_device(id);//主动触发,读取装置版本配置信息,仅在装置登录后执行一次,当前获取版本信息确认对时报文结构。 ClientManager::instance().read_devversion_action_to_device(id);//主动触发,读取装置版本配置信息,仅在装置登录后执行一次,当前获取版本信息确认对时报文结构。
@@ -501,6 +502,7 @@ void process_received_message(string mac, string id,const char* data, size_t len
data_time, data_time,
mac, mac,
avg_data.name); avg_data.name);
DIY_INFOLOG_CODE(id, 1, static_cast<int>(LogCode::LOG_CODE_REPORT), "装置推送统计数据完毕");
} }
} }